Living In the Moment

I just want to be on it 
I mean I want to live in the moment
You only have one life to live 
And that's what I plan to do
I want to enjoy the view 
The breathe of fresh Air , I want to care 
About every second every hour 
I want to be that flower 
That grows and never dies 
Live in the moment
By a surprise,do everything right
In God eyes,live for now not for later 
Within me, is something greater
We will not live forever 
Yes I know, so for knowing want
To seize the moment
Like it's my last
Leave the past in the past 
I just want to tell the world and let them see 
What a moment looks like
And in a blink 
It could be over 
So I want to let 
The emotions roll off 
Know that everything
Comes with a cost 
But the cost I want is to be free
Free of hurt,free of pain 
Free of memories that are not important
Free to receive God's annointment
And the opportunities
Jump on it 
Living in the moment

Written by: Concetta Hardnett
